Common Questions About Coding Classes Near Alpharetta

How can coding help kids?

Many folks might think learning to code is so kids can actually code an app. Honestly, that's not usually the case! Coding real-life apps is tough. Despite what the media says, your kid is not writing some million dollar app by themselves in a month. Instead, coding helps kid *solve problems*. Coding is all about debugging and logically thinking through the fix. Breaking a large problem into smaller parts, logical sequencing, these are all important problem solving skills for any kid (or adult!). A second benefit is confidence and passion in technology. There's plenty of time for kids to learn the latest real tech (which changes all the time), but the time to build passion for technology (and a foundational knowledge base) is when they're young!

Do you teach Artificial Intelligence (AI)?

Learning AI comes in many flavors, and we teach them all. In our view, learning AI is separated into:
  1. Using AI - Integrate AI models into custom code, including Scratch for our younger coders.
  2. Understanding AI - Explore how AI works under the covers structurally
  3. Refining Coding Skills - AI is all code and data, so it's important to be a proficient coder before learning even more
  4. Coding with AI - Our proficient coders can use AI extensions to help code much faster
  5. Building AI - Our most advanced coders may be able to dig into the details of how AI is built
Come in and chat with us to find out whether learning AI is right for your child.

What is the best coding language to learn as a beginner?

The truth is, Scratch is amazing for a beginner at ANY AGE. If someone is truly a beginner, a platform like Scratch can allow them to create and engage much more quickly. Older kids (say 11 and up) can soon move to a language like Python or Javascript. Just remember that it takes a LOT MORE work to get Python/Javascript to do the same thing as Scratch - so the kids will need some patience. No matter what anyone tells you please DO NOT start learning with Java or C++! Those languages are too advanced to start with, and we've seen it too often - kids will give up because it's so hard! Definition of backfiring!

Can a 6 year old do coding?

Sure! Kids this young are just developing their sense of logic. While some advanced 6 year olds are ready to dive into learning Scratch, many are better off with fun learning apps like Kodable or Scratch Jr..
